Hijack attempt on Ukraine to Turkey airliner: report

Istanbul: A Ukrainian man attempted on Friday to hijack an airliner en route from Ukraine to Turkey and divert it to Sochi where the Winter Olympics are taking place, Turkish media reports said.

The man claimed there was a bomb on board the Pegasus Airlines aircraft, tried to gain access to the cockpit and was carrying a detonator, the unconfirmed reports said.

The pilot managed to sound the alert and an F-16 Turkish military jet was scrambled, forcing the plane with some 110 passengers on board to land in Istanbul, the reports said.

Turkish anti-terrorist commandos and armed police were searching all the passengers the aircraft for explosives, the reports said.
